Sentinel-4
🇪🇺Mission Profile
Sentinel-4 is an ESA instrument planned for hosting on a Meteosat Third Generation - Sounder (MTG-S) satellite, dedicated to monitoring atmospheric composition — particularly air quality pollutants including ozone, nitrogen dioxide, sulfur dioxide, and aerosols — over Europe and adjacent regions from geostationary orbit. Unlike earlier Sentinel atmospheric missions in low Earth orbit, Sentinel-4's geostationary position enables hourly monitoring of atmospheric chemistry variations throughout the daylight hours, providing a near-real-time view of pollution events, photochemical processes, and volcanic emissions at continental scale. The instrument will provide operational support to European air quality authorities and emergency services while feeding climate models with continuous atmospheric chemistry data.
